Meanwhile, TV celebrity Li Tien-i and her husband have also been listed as defendants in a breach of trust case, in which they are suspected of over-reporting US$250,000 in a wild animal transaction with Sanlih E-Television CEO Chang Rong-hua.
Former Sanlih E-Television presenter Li Tien-i's husband, Kuo Jen-chieh, was silent upon arrival at the district prosecutors office. When a reporter asked him if he over-reported expenditures, he couldn't resist responding.
Reporter: “Why not give us an explanation.”
Kuo Jen-chieh, Defendant: “I hope there won't be any use of public authority to interfere with normal contract negotiations. I would also like to ask all reporters to understand the actual situation. Thank you.”
Li and her friend Li Wu-ta were taken by Investigation Bureau personnel to the Taipei District Prosecutors Office for a second round of questioning. Upon seeing cameras, Li Tien-i told reporters to be careful but didn't respond to their questions.
Reporter: “Do you think CEO Chang (Chang Rong-hua) is settling accounts?”
Li Tien-i, Defendant: “The weather is very cold, so please be careful. Thank you.”
Prosecutors questioned the trio on Feb. 21. Many years ago, Sanlih E-Television CEO Chang Rong-hua took over Wanpi World Safari Zoo. At that time, he used a joint venture operated by the trio to import animals including rhinos. Prosecutors discovered that the trio over-reported the import price for a profit of US$250,000 or approximately NT$7 million. They have been indicted for breach of trust. After another round of questioning, bail was set at NT$500,000, NT$400,000 and NT$300,000 for Li Tien-i, Kuo, and Li Wu-ta, respectively. Meanwhile, the television company said Li Tien-i already resigned and all her presenter duties were suspended after the case entered the judicial process. Another presenter has been assigned to the program she previously presented. Wanpi World Safari Zoo said it cannot comment as the investigation is not public. The trio all posted bail and departed immediately, ignoring the media as they left.
